Generally, home insurance coverage financially protects your home incase something were to happen to it. For instance, if there were a theft or a fire, it could easily be protected. This way if anything gets damaged you will be covered. It not only allows you to be able to move temporarily when your home needs to get repaired, but it protects your assets if a disturbance were to occur.

However, what one does need to know is that a lot of situations are not covered in basic home insurance. For example, homeowners insurance in Texas urges you to buy an extra hurricane package. This is because hurricanes are quite common in these areas, thus it is important to be aware of what your insurance plan covers. Many companies offer a state sponsored hurricane insurance package, however it can get costly if you are adding up extra fees. Another type of situation that usually is never included in a normal home insurance plan is flood insurance. This assurance will not only protect you from any damages that may occur in your home, but will also financially help you incase your possessions are ruined. While this is a great insurance plan to purchase, it may be smart to do some research beforehand. For instance, if you live in Florida where hurricanes are common and flooding occurs frequently, it is extremely smart to purchase this. On the other hand, if you have homeowners insurance in Connecticut and never have experienced a flood, you may just want basic coverage.
